Define the goal of the Marine Corps promotion system. - answer The goal of the
Marine Corps promotion system is to advance the best qualified Marines to the next
higher grade.

The components of METT-T are: - answer Mission
Enemy
Terrain and Weather
Troops and Fire Support Available
-
Time

Immediate actions are designed to provide? - answer Swift and positive small unit
reaction to visible or physical contact with the enemy.
What are the 6 steps to remember when conducting a patrol? - answer 1)
reconnoiter and complete the estimate
2) complete the plan
3) prepare the order
4) issue the order
5) supervise - inspect - rehearse
6) execute the mission
